Introduction

A new movie called Bandar is in theaters. Bobby Deol is the main actor. People like the movie, but not many people paid to see it.

Main Body

The movie is about a man named Samar. He is a famous actor, but he has big problems with the law. Director Anurag Kashyap says Bobby Deol did a great job. He acted with a lot of emotion.

Bandar did not make much money. It made 1.27 crore rupees in two days. Another movie called Hai Jawani Toh Ishq Hona Hai made more money because it was in more theaters.

Other actors are also doing well. Rakesh Bedi is in a very popular movie series. Also, Bobby Deol's family is very happy for him. His brother and sister say he is a great actor.

The 'But' Bridge

In the story, we see a pattern where one good thing is followed by a bad thing. We use the word but to connect these two opposite ideas.

How it works: [Good thing] \rightarrow but \rightarrow [Bad thing]

Examples from the text:

  • People like the movie \rightarrow but \rightarrow not many people paid to see it.
  • He is a famous actor \rightarrow but \rightarrow he has big problems.
